Hiker found dead after fall from Lower Table Rock cliffs
Jackson County authorities recover body after reported missing person incident
Apr. 10, 2026 at 12:49am

A tragic hiking accident exposes the risks of exploring remote natural areas without proper precautions.Central Point TodayA 28-year-old man died after falling from the cliffs at Lower Table Rock in Central Point, Oregon. The Jackson County Sheriff's Office Search and Rescue team responded to a missing person call on Tuesday night and found the man's body the next morning. Authorities are investigating the incident but say there is no evidence of foul play.
Why it matters
Hiking accidents and falls from cliffs are an ongoing public safety concern in the region, especially at popular outdoor recreation areas like Lower Table Rock. This incident highlights the need for caution and safety measures when exploring natural areas with steep terrain.
The details
According to the Jackson County Sheriff's Office, deputies and Search and Rescue volunteers were called to the Lower Table Rock trail around 9:38 p.m. on Tuesday, April 9 for a report of a missing hiker. The team located the 28-year-old man's body the following morning, and determined he had fallen from the cliffs. Authorities are investigating the incident but say there are no signs of foul play.
- The incident was reported to authorities on Tuesday, April 9 at 9:38 p.m.
- The man's body was recovered on Wednesday morning, April 10
The players
Jackson County Sheriff's Office
The local law enforcement agency that responded to the incident and is leading the investigation.
Jackson County Sheriff's Office Search and Rescue
The team of deputies and volunteers that searched for and recovered the victim's body.
